  • Must visit

Wadsworth Atheneum Museum of Art

The oldest continuously operating public art museum in the U.S., with major European, American, and contemporary collections in a landmark building.

  • Must visit

The Mark Twain House & Museum

This acclaimed historic house museum preserves Mark Twain’s ornate home and brings his writing, family life, and era vividly to life.

  • Recommended

Harriet Beecher Stowe Center

A literary and social history museum in Harriet Beecher Stowe’s home, exploring abolition, reform, and the author’s Hartford years.

United States Dollar ($)

Moderate for U.S. city travel: hotels and dining are mid-priced, transit is limited, and downtown costs are usually lower than Boston or New York.

Average meal costs

Budget
$10-18 for fast food or casual takeout.
Mid-range
$20-40 per person for a mid-range restaurant meal.
Fine dining
$60+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
$3-6 for coffee or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Tip 18-20% at restaurants, $1-2 per drink at bars, and 10-15% for taxis. Cafes often have tip jars or card prompts for small tips.

Some of the most interesting sights to explore in Hartford, CT are:
  • Mark Twain House & Museum, the historic home of the famous author offering guided tours and exhibits
  • Wadsworth Atheneum Museum of Art, the oldest public art museum in the U.S. featuring European and American collections
  • Connecticut Science Center, an interactive science museum with hands-on exhibits and a 3D theater
  • Bushnell Park, a large public park with walking paths, a carousel, and the Soldiers and Sailors Memorial Arch
  • Harriet Beecher Stowe Center, the preserved home of the author of Uncle Tom's Cabin with tours and educational programs.

For international flights we recommend to arrive 2.5 to 3 hours before departure. Please check the website of your departure airport if in doubt. Some airports may offer booking time slots for security checks or offer additional information on when to get there based on time of day.
Most airlines permit carry-on bags that fit within specific dimensions (e.g., 22 x 14 x 9 inches or 56 x 36 x 23 cm), including handles and wheels. Bags must f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.
Many airlines impose weight limits, commonly ranging between 7 kg (15 lbs) and 12 kg (26 lbs). Typically, passengers are allowed one carry-on bag and one personal item (for example a purse, laptop bag, or backpack). Personal items must fit under the seat in front of you. Budget Airlines (like Ryanair or Wizz Air) have stricter size and weight limits, often requiring fees for larger carry-ons. Full-Service Airlines have more lenient policies, sometimes including more spacious dimensions or higher weight limits depending on your ticket class.
The list of items prohibited on an airplane varies by country and airline, but in general, the following items are not allowed in carry-on or checked baggage: Weapons and self-defence items, sharp objects, flammable materials, explosives, toxic substances, or liquids over 100ml (except for medications and baby essentials). In checked baggage, firearms (without authorization), explosives, large lithium batteries, and hazardous chemicals are prohibited. Electronic cigarettes must be in carry-on bags, while alcohol and dry ice have restrictions. Always check with your airline for specific regulations.
The currency used in the United States is the US Dollar (USD). For travelers, using cards is generally more convenient and widely accepted, especially credit and debit cards, while cash is useful for small purchases or places that do not accept cards.
In Hartford, CT, travelers should be cautious of petty crimes such as pickpocketing and vehicle break-ins, especially in crowded or poorly lit areas. Common scams include overcharging by unofficial taxi services and fraudulent ticket sales for local attractions or transportation. Staying in well-populated areas, using licensed transportation, and verifying ticket sources help ensure a safe visit.
